Plants vs Brainrots — Complete Plant List:

There are 13 Plants in the game, the complete Plant List is here.

PlantRaritySeed CostBase DMG
CactusRare$20010
StrawberryRare$1,25025
PumpkinEpic$5,00055
SunflowerEpic$25,000115
Dragon FruitLegendary$100,000250
EggplantLegendary$250,000500
WatermelonMythic$1,000,000750
CocotankGodly$5,000,0001,200
Carnivorous PlantGodly$25,000,0002,200
Mr CarrotSecret$50,000,0003,500
TomatiroSecret$125,000,0004,500
ShroombinoSecret$200,000,00012,500
GrapeMythic$2,500,0001,750

Tip: Secret plants rotate stock, so grab them when you see them—especially Shroombino, which wrecks waves with its huge hit.

Plants vs Brainrots: Detailed Guide to Each Plant (2025)

Here’s an in-depth look at every key plant you’ll grow in Plants vs Brainrots. This guide covers their rarity, cost, damage output, and how they can fit into your garden strategy. Let’s get into the heart of your garden arsenal.

Cactus

Cactus is a Rare plant costing $200 seeds and deals 10 base damage. It’s your reliable early-game defender, great for absorbing hits while chipping away at weak Brainrots. Its low cost means you can plant several quickly.

Strawberry

Strawberry is Rare with a higher seed cost of $1,250 and base damage of 25. It balances price and punch, excellent for early to mid-game waves. Also commonly used as a fusion ingredient to unlock stronger plants.

Pumpkin

Pumpkin is an Epic plant priced at $5,000 seeds and offers 55 base damage. It’s a tougher, sturdier option with solid offensive stats, often used as frontline defense in mixed setups.

Sunflower

Sunflower is Epic and costs $25,000 seeds to plant. It hits 115 base damage, surprising for a plant named after a traditional “sun producer.” The Sunflower doubles as a damage dealer and strategic plant for mid-game pushing.

Dragon Fruit

Dragon Fruit is Legendary at $100,000 seed cost, delivering 250 base damage. This fiery fruit brings high damage at a still-manageable price, perfect for building towards late-game defense.

Eggplant

Eggplant has Legendary status with a hefty $250,000 seed price and 500 base damage. It excels at clearing groups of Brainrots and works well with mutations for explosive power.

Watermelon

Watermelon is Mythic, coming in at $1,000,000 seed cost and 750 base damage. This plant packs a punch that can control enemy hordes across multiple lanes, a must-have for higher chapter pushes.

Cocotank

The Cocotank, Godly rarity priced at $5,000,000 seeds, hits 1,200 base damage. As its name suggests, it combines tankiness with heavy firepower, anchoring your defense against waves of Brainrots.

Carnivorous Plant

Another Godly plant costing $25,000,000 seeds, the Carnivorous Plant dishes out 2,200 damage. It’s brutal against tougher enemies and synergizes well with slowed or frozen conditions.

Mr Carrot

Mr Carrot is a Secret-level plant—rare and powerful—demanding $50,000,000 seeds and offering 3,500 damage. Its unique stats make it a game-changer for high-end players seeking serious offensive power.

Tomatiro

Tomatiro stands out as another Secret plant with a massive $125,000,000 seed cost and 4,500 base damage. Its high damage output can turn the tide during boss fights and difficult levels.

Shroombino

Shroombino is the pinnacle Secret plant at $200,000,000 seed cost and 12,500 base damage. It’s famously known as the “game breaker” due to its devastating damage and is highly prized by experienced gardeners.

Grape

Grape rides in as a Mythic plant costing $2,500,000 seeds, delivering 1,750 damage. It excels at both offense and synergy with other fruit plants, boasting decent cost-efficiency for mid-late game.

Mutation Levels (Plants):

  • Gold: 2x base damage
  • Diamond: 3x base damage
  • Neon: 4.5x base damage
  • Frozen: 4x base damage (and short freeze on enemies)

Plants vs Brainrots — Complete Brainrot List

There are 28 Brainrots in the game and here is the complete Brainrot List:

BrainrotRarityNormal $/s
Noobini BananiniRare$2
Tung Tung SahurRare$2
Trulimero TrulicinaRare$3
Orangutini AnanassiniRare$3
Pipi KiwiRare$3
Lirili LarilaRare$4
Boneca AmbalabuRare$5
Fluri FluraRare$6
Brr Brr PatapimEpic$12
Svinino BombondinoEpic$12
Cappuccino AssasinoEpic$13
Trippi TroppiEpic$15
Ballerina CappuccinaLegendary$25
Bananita DolphinitaLegendary$32
Gangster FooteraLegendary$36
Burbaloni LulliloliLegendary$41
Elefanto CocofantoLegendary$42
MadungLegendary$45
Frigo CameloMythic$126
Bombardiro CrocodiloMythic$180
Bombini GussiniMythic$180
Odin Din Din DunGodly$360
Giraffa CelesteGodly$420
Tralalelp TralalaGodly$575
MatteoGodly$600
Los TralaleritosSecret$1,200
Vacca Saturno SaturnitaSecret$1,200
GaramararamSecret$2,100

Mutation Levels (Brainrots):

  • Gold: 2x base income
  • Diamond: 3x base income
  • Neon: 4.5x base income
  • Frozen: 4x base income

How Mutations Work (Quick Refresher):

When a plant or brainrot mutates, it can jump in power—sometimes overnight. Gold’s the most common and doubles your value. Neon can turn a weak plant into your main wave-clearer or make even a tiny Brainrot start earning like a boss.

Most Effective Mutations for Plants

  • Neon: Boosts base damage by 4.5x. It’s the top choice for wave clearing and boss melting.
  • Diamond: Raises base damage by 3x. Great for consistency and progressing through tougher chapters.
  • Frozen: Multiplies base damage by 4x and adds a short freeze effect to enemies. Use this for stalling bosses and buying time in swarm waves.
  • Gold: Doubles base damage (2x). Reliable and easy to get, making it perfect for mid-game builds.

Most Effective Mutations for Brainrots

  • Neon: Increases base income by 4.5x. You’ll earn far more cash per second, which helps with rapid upgrades.
  • Diamond: Triples base income (3x). Good for stacking dollar-per-second, especially on legendary brainrots.
  • Frozen: Multiplies income by 4x. Rare, but exceptional for both earnings and occasional stall tactics.
  • Gold: Doubles normal $/s (2x). Useful on all tiers and simple to achieve during events.

Best Strategy: Stack Neon or Frozen on your highest rarity plants and brainrots first. Combine Diamond mutations on supporting units. Aim for Gold mutations throughout your entire lineup as a baseline upgrade.

If you hit Neon or Frozen on a Secret-tier plant or brainrot, keep it and build your strategy around it. Those mutations can make a tough level suddenly feel easy.

Common Challenges and Solutions

  • Struggling to get Secret plants: Watch the shop and keep cash saved, then prioritize stock shop refresh times.
  • Brainrots are earning slow: Always fuse for mutations or reroll with weather events for Neons.
  • Plants dying too fast: Layer Epics with slows in front and beefier Legendaries behind.
  • Not seeing mutations: Use weather events, fusions, and spend sun on reroll chances.

Expert Tips & Strategies

  • Rush Mythics for early pushes, then slot in Godlys once you’ve built up sun currency.
  • Always check mutation bonuses before selling or fusing—Neon and Diamond multiply your progress massively.
  • Secrets can turn a bad run into a win. Don’t sell a Secret plant or brainrot unless you’re desperate for cash.
